PSMC Alumnus Dr. Harikrishna Doshi Appointed Co-Chair of Society for Cardiothoracic Surgery of Great Britain and Ireland
Bhaikaka University is proud to share that Dr. Harikrishna Doshi, a student of the very first batch of Pramukhswami Medical College (PSMC) (MBBS Batch of 1987), has been appointed as Co-Chair of the Society for Cardiothoracic Surgery (SCTS) of Great Britain and Ireland.
Dr. Doshi, who has been based in Glasgow, Scotland, for the past 20 years, currently serves as a Consultant Cardiac and Transplant Surgeon at Golden Jubilee University National Hospital. This prestigious leadership role will enable him to contribute significantly to shaping the future of adult cardiac surgery across the United Kingdom and Ireland.
The Society for Cardiothoracic Surgery represents surgeons from England, Scotland, Wales, Northern Ireland, and the Republic of Ireland, and plays a vital role in advancing clinical standards, research, education, workforce planning, and national cardiac surgery programmes.
Adding to this remarkable achievement, Dr. Doshi was honoured with an Outstanding Achievement Award by the Scottish Asian business community in December 2025 for his exceptional contributions to heart transplantation. During his acceptance speech, he also raised awareness about the importance of organ donation, reflecting his continued commitment to patient care and public service.
